1.a nurse in a čliničal is čaring for a middle age adult who states, "the dočtor says that
sinče I am at an average risk for čolon čančer, I should have a routine sčreening. what
does that involve?" whičh of the following responsesshould the nurse make?
A."I'll get a blood sample from you and send it for a sčreening test."
B."beginning at age 60, you should have a čolonosčopy."
C."you should have a dečal oččult blood test every year."
D."the rečommendation is to have a sigmoidosčopy every 10 years."
"You should have a fečal oččult blood test every year."
Colorečtal čančer sčreening for člients at average risk begins at age 50. Oneoption for
sčreening is a fečal oččult blood test annually.

2.a nurse is čaring for a člient who is having diffičulty breathing. the člient is laying in
bed with a nasal čannula delivering oxygen. whičh of the followingintervention should
the nurse take first?
A.sučtion the člient's airway
B.administer a brončhodilator
C.inčrease the humidity in the člient's room
D.assist the člient to an upright position
assist the člient to an upright position
When providing člient čare, the nurse should first use the least invasive intervention.
Therefore, the nurse should elevate the head of the člient's bed tothe semi-Fowler's or high
Fowler's position to fačilitate maximal čhest expansion. Sitting upright improves gas
exčhange and prevents pressure on thediaphragm from abdominal organs.
